  • Credulity - Wikipedia
    Meaning The words gullible and credulous are commonly used as synonyms Goepp Kay (1984) state that while both words mean "unduly trusting or confiding", gullibility stresses being duped or made a fool of, suggesting a lack of intelligence, whereas credulity stresses uncritically forming beliefs, suggesting a lack of skepticism [3]
  • CREDULITY Definition Meaning | Dictionary. com
    Credulity means gullibility, or a willingness to believe anything Credulity is a tendency to believe in things too easily and without evidence If a swindler is trying to sell you fake medicine, then he is "preying on your credulity " This noun is associated with being naïve, gullible or innocent
